cole
- (uncountable, usually) Cabbage.
- (uncountable, usually) Brassica; a plant of the Brassica genus, especially those of Brassica oleracea (rape and coleseed).

Etymology
In summary
From Middle English cole, col, from Old English cawel, from Germanic, from Latin caulis (“cabbage”). Cognate with Dutch kool, German Kohl, Danish kål, Norwegian Bokmål kål, Norwegian Nynorsk kål, Swedish kål. Doublet of caulis, gobi, and kale.
